Step 4 — Promote ParityLens to production. ParityLens, our hotel rate-parity checker at Wrenmoor Travel Labs, compares posted rates across booking channels every fifteen minutes, so a stale deploy can trigger false mismatch alerts for hundreds of properties. Confirm the canary ran clean for two full comparison cycles before promoting. The release artifact must be re-signed at promotion time; the pipeline validates it against the deploy key shown below.

release key, tajep-tahaf: bky19_d9NV5NtNvNNQVVKBK4P

Ticket: SIG-442 — Webhook signature check failing on retries

Plugin hooks from Brindlecast reject retried deliveries. Cause: retries re-sign with rotated key, but plugins cache the old one. Fix: fetch the current key on each verification failure before rejecting. Retries stop after five attempts. Verify retried payloads against the key below.

deploy key for kahof-tadup: bky4_rRMZ

## Account Recovery — Trailnote Offline Mode

When a surveyor's Trailnote app has been offline for 30+ days, their local credentials expire and sync refuses to resume. Don't make them wipe the device — all their unsynced field data lives there! Instead, open the support console, pick "Offline Reinstate," and enter their handle. The console will ask for the support team's shared recovery passphrase before issuing a reinstatement token. Use the one below.

unlock words, bagaf-fajeg: zorael-kelax-fraath-quenix-eliok-sileth-aldmir-wenir-druiel

Load test review — Cartwheel checkout flow. Ran 4,000 virtual users against staging; p95 latency held at 820ms until the payment-intent step, which degraded past 2,500 users due to lock contention in the reservation table. Agreed to shard reservations by region before the next run. Ongoing ownership of the follow-up fixes rests with the engineer named below.

named custodian: Brivan Eliath Quenox Frador